Well, for the guys who can make some money, here's another plan: Go for $3000 to win!
Make the tow from Texas to Warren, Arkansas on Saturday. It's a $2000
to win, one-day show for a $30 entry fee and $140 to start the A.
Now
on the way back, go through Shreveport to Boothill
Speedway where they are having a 2-day show paying $1000 to win and
$100 to start on NO entry fee. Qualifying is Saturday and last chance
races and features are Sunday afternoon at 2PM. You can start on the
back of a last chance race Sunday afternoon (behind the Saturday cars)
at no penalty.
The tricky part is, you will not get any hot laps
on Sunday and you will have to figure out a way to pass on the 3/8-mile
paperclip style oval after racing a well banked, 1/4-mile oval on
Saturday night (gear change??), in the daylight to make the show. Not
easy but not impossible but after pocketing $2000 why not try for
another $1000 on the way home? NO entry fee, $30 pit pass.
The
weather is supposed to clear out in time for both tracks on Saturday
but just in case something lingers in the area toward the northeast,
then you at least have a back-up with Boothill doing qualifying on
Saturday night and you can get a good starting spot for Sunday's $1000
instead of the weekend being a total loss.
